For the dissociation of gaseous `HI, 2HI(g) hArr H_(2)(g)+I_(2)(g)`. If 2 moles of HI are taken initially and `20%` HI is dissociated at equilibrium then the value of `K_(c)` in a 1 litre flask at 300K will be
